Each week brings new themes and teachers with a variety of arts, movement, theater, and music expertise. From set design, to acting, from painting to sculpture, from designing to building, let your k-5th grader explore the world of creativity with professional guidance and fun activities. Morning camps run from 8:30 am-12 pm and afternoon camps run from 1-4:30. Campers who enroll in both the morning and afternoon camps will join other campers for a supervised lunch at the Depot Art Center or the Park.

Dive into a variety of creative adventures with Young at Art School Days Off! Campers will enjoy days full of fun, games, movement, and a healthy dose of creativity. Students will participate in a variety of arts and craft projects, group games, outdoor play, and exciting adventures. It’s an opportunity to unplug, enjoy hands-on learning, build confidence, collaboration, and try a plethora of new activities.
Cancelation and Refund Policies
School Day Out Camps
- We do not offer refunds for the cancellation of Young at Art School Day Out Camps.
- You may transfer your young artist into another Young at Art School Day Out Camp if the transfer request is made, in writing, at least 2 weeks prior to the enrolled camp. Transfers can only be made to another Camp within the same school year season.
Summer Camps
- Prior to June 1st, refunds can be given for Young at Art Summer Camps – minus a non-refundable $35 administration fee. Requests must be made in writing.
- You may transfer your young artist to another Young at Art Summer Camp, with the same cost, if there is space available and the transfer request is made in writing, prior to June 1. Transfers can only be made to another camp within the same Summer Camp season.
Steamboat Creates reserves the right to cancel or reschedule a Young at Art camp for any reason, including canceling a camp that does not meet minimum registration requirements or canceling a camp due to inclement weather. If SC cancels a camp, paid registrants will be given a full refund.
